For many guests, a stay at Victoria Falls marks the beginning of a Zimbabwe adventure, a day or two soaking up the spectacle of one of the world’s great natural wonders before heading deep into northern Hwange National Park to Hideaways Bumbusi Wilderness Camp. And there is no more memorable way to arrive in the African bush than by helicopter.
Lifting off just minutes from the Falls, the flight begins with a flip directly over Victoria Falls itself. From up here, the Zambezi River narrows and then disappears entirely into the churning white of the Batoka Gorge, mist rising high into the air around you. The journey to Bumbusi can be experienced in more than one way. While road transfers through Hwange offer their own rewarding wildlife encounters, the helicopter flight adds an unforgettable view from above, reaching camp in roughly 20 minutes. The helicopter transfer is available both into and out of Hideaways Bumbusi Wilderness Camp, meaning your safari can begin and end above the African bush. Whether you are arriving in Hwange or departing to Victoria Falls with one last breathtaking view of the wilds below.
